Basement Walls Waterproofing in Greenville, SC
Basement walls waterproofing services focus on protecting the foundation of a home from moisture intrusion, water seepage, and potential damage caused by excess humidity or leaks. These services typically involve applying specialized sealants, installing drainage systems, or adding interior and exterior barriers to prevent water from penetrating basement walls. Projects can range from addressing existing leaks and dampness issues to proactive waterproofing during new construction or renovation efforts, helping homeowners maintain a dry, stable basement environment.
Property owners interested in basement walls waterproofing usually want to understand the methods used, the scope of work involved, and how the service can help prevent issues like mold growth, structural deterioration, or damage to belongings stored in the basement. It’s also common to seek information about the signs of water intrusion, such as efflorescence, musty odors, or visible cracks, to determine if waterproofing is needed. Proper assessment and clear explanations of available solutions can assist homeowners in making informed decisions to protect their property investment.

Common Basement Walls Waterproofing Jobs
Basement wall sealing - prevents water infiltration and protects foundation integrity.
Crack repair - addresses existing wall cracks to stop leaks and further damage.
Interior waterproofing - installs drainage systems and vapor barriers inside the basement.
Exterior waterproofing - applies membranes and drainage solutions to the outside of basement walls.
Waterproof coating application - adds a protective barrier to resist moisture penetration.
Drainage system installation - directs water away from the foundation to prevent pooling and seepage.
Basement Walls Waterproofing Questions
What are common signs of basement wall issues? Cracks, bowing walls, or moisture buildup can indicate waterproofing needs.
How does waterproofing help basement walls? It prevents water infiltration, reducing damage and maintaining a dry, stable space.
What types of projects typically require basement wall waterproofing? Foundations with existing leaks, cracks, or signs of moisture often benefit from waterproofing solutions.
Is waterproofing suitable for all basement types? Most basements with concrete or masonry walls can be waterproofed to improve moisture resistance.
